CHANGING THE TIRES
Temporary spare tire information
The temporary spare
tire for your vehicle is
labeled as such. It is
smaller than a regular
tire and is designed for
emergency use only.
If you use the temporary spare tire
continuously or do not follow these
precautions, the tire could fail, causing you to lose
control of the vehicle, possibly injuring yourself or
others.
When driving with the temporary spare tire DO
NOT:
exceed 80 km/h (50 mph) under any
circumstances
load the vehicle beyond maximum vehicle load
rating listed on the Safety Compliance Label
tow a trailer
use tire chains
drive through an automatic car wash, because of
the vehicle’s ground clearance
try to repair the temporary spare tire or remove it
from its wheel
use the wheel for any other type of vehicle
